OPay’s NightGuard saved me from losing my life savings
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Linkedin

Since the launch of this innovative security feature, OPay’s NightGuard has become the trusted go-to security feature for countless users, offering an added layer of protection for online transactions during the most vulnerable hours of the night.

As digital transactions become an integral part of everyday life, ensuring customer security has never been more critical.

NightGuard, with its innovative facial recognition technology, ensures that only the rightful account-owner can authorize payments during late-night hours, safeguarding users from potential fraud and unauthorized access to your funds.

About OPay

OPay was established in 2018 as a leading financial institution in Nigeria with the mission to make financial services more inclusive through technology. The company offers a wide range of payment services, including money transfer, bill payment, airtime & data purchase, card service, and merchant payments, among others. Renowned for its super-fast experience and reliable network, OPay is licensed by the CBN and insured by the NDIC with the same insurance coverage as commercial banks.
